III. COMPANY DESCRIPTION

Our business specializes in selling Nilupak with a chocolate twist to the SHS students of Nagpayong High
School. Nilupak is a traditional Filipino snack or dessert, typically made from cassava, but we've
innovatively crafted it from saba banana infused with chocolate to cater to the tastes of millennials. Our
manufacturing process relies on manual labor rather than machinery. Challenges include competition
with classmates and the school canteen, as well as the task of encouraging customers to make a
purchase. With a high school population that's potentially interested, the challenge is to meet rising
demand. Our business choice is manufacturing, focused on fulfilling the nutritional needs of Grade 11
students, offering them a nutritious and cost-effective snack. While other products may be sweeter,
Nilupak stands out for its nutritional value.
